GM Notes Last year, I ran an assassination mission with my group, which at that time was a Rebel Spec Force Ops Team. They had to kill Commander Ayala, who was the engineer in charge of the second design of the Death Star. So, they snuck on to Coruscant, and broke into a hotel that Commander Ayala was in. After raiding it, they escaped with information that Commander Ayala was inside the Imperial Palace in the 29th floor luxury suites. So, they broke into the palace through the sewer system, and made their way up to the floor. Amazingly only one of them died. While the rest were checking rooms on the 29th, two of my players (a coynyte and a merc) set up an E-Web by the elevator door. During the fray, the elevator door opened, and one of my PC's opened up with the repeater and killed two ST's, and damaged the elevator so badly that it dropped. They then had to repel down the elevator shaft to the nearest docking bay. Where they actually made it out. Suicide Squad Bob "Every man dies.
